Futamune-zukuri homestead in Okinawa

This type of homestead with separate roofs was once commonly found throughout the Okinawa region, but it is now only rarely seen except on Taketomi Island. The main house, where people slept, was open and well ventilated, with a raised floor. The separate building a short distance from the main house was for cooking. It had few openings, and was dirt-floored. Originally, the stove was built very simply, by arranging three stones in a set pattern.
